Our UpCycled Chicken Coop- Day 1

Yesterday I posted about how I want to build an Upcycled chicken coop with pallets. I also wrote that I want a big window and a sound floor, you can see that posts !

Today is the first day of actual work, we found 20 pallets to start building the walls. First step is to pull aside the 6 best pallets we have for the walls. Something with even spacing between the boards and they all have to be the same size, we will call these wall pallets. Second step is to pull aside 5 pallets to cannibalize. Pallets with boards roughly the same size as the gaps on your wall pallets. Take your reciprocating saw with a construction blade and cut the nail between the board and the stringer. Remove all top boards, you will need them to fill in the gaps on your wall pallets. Note: if you are using a cordless reciprocating saw you battery will die very fast. 1 battery lasted 2 pallets.

Next you will need to make sure your cut boards fit in the empty space of the wall pallets. Since they aren’t measured you may need to cut them down a little bit more. I was not a fan of the table saw!!!

So for today we were able to finish 6 pallets

A good coop for thee to four birds should cost you in the region of ₤ 300 though this could rely on whether you elect for a totally free standing house or one with a run attached. Thinking you are ranging your birds in a large space as well as the pop hole doorway is big sufficient for the breed you maintain, then the main demands of real estate boil down to three factors which will specify the number of birds your house will hold; perches, nest boxes as well as ventilation. A lot of types of chicken will certainly perch when they go to roost at night, this perch should ideally be 5-8cm wide with smoothed off edges so the foot sits conveniently on it. The perch needs to be more than the nest box entrance as chickens will additionally normally seek the acme to perch. A perch lower than that will certainly have the birds roosting in the nest box over night (which is incidentally when they generate the most poo) resulting in dirtied eggs the list below day. They should not nonetheless be so high off the floor of your house that leg injuries could possibly take place when the bird gets down in the early morning. Chickens need concerning 20cm of perch each (in little breeds this is certainly much less), plus if more than one perch is mounted in your home they need to be more than 30cm apart. They will certainly hunker up with their next-door neighbors however are not that keen on roosting with a beak in the bloomers of the bird in front. Ideally your house ought to have a least one nest box for each 3 birds as well as these need to be off the ground and also in the darkest area of your home. Your home should have ample ventilation: without it then condensation will certainly accumulate every night, even in the coldest of weather. Realize, ventilation works on the concept of cozy air leaving through a high space drawing cooler air in from a lower space - it's not a collection of holes on contrary wall surfaces of your house and also at the same level, this is just what's called a draft.
